How to Spot the Real “Fast” Operators

First, look beyond the glossy homepage banners. A legitimate “fast withdrawal” service will list:

  • Exact processing windows (e.g., “Withdrawals processed within 12 hours post‑KYC”).
  • Clear KYC steps that can be completed before you even deposit.
  • Transparent fee structures – no hidden “processing fees” that appear after the fact.

Second, test the waters with the smallest possible Flexepin amount. If a casino balks at a $10 deposit, it’s a red flag. The reason is simple: they prefer bigger sums that mask their internal inefficiencies. Small‑scale testing also reveals whether the payout mechanism is truly automated or just a smokescreen for a manual backlog.

Third, read the community forums. Unibet’s user base, for instance, routinely shares screenshots of withdrawal timestamps. Their consensus: the platform’s “fast withdrawal” claim holds up, but only for verified accounts that have completed their identity checks months in advance. The irony is that the “instant” label is only meaningful if you’ve already been through a vetting process that takes longer than the withdrawal itself.
